Question on 05 LGT Keyless Entry/Factory Alarm
My wife and I just picked up our new 05 LGT Ltd. this morning. We've noticed a little problem with the factory alarm and we're not too sure if we're just doing something wrong.
When we get out of the car and lock the car with the remote, we noticed the security light on the dash blinks rapidly. Then, about 30 seconds later, the alarm goes off. If we press any button on the remote (except panic), it stops and the security light flashes at the normal rate. I made sure we were not touching the remote's panic button or anything. I tested this at least 10 times now with the same results. If we lock the door with the key, everything works normally. I checked the owner's manual and couldn't find anything that could definitely be causing this. The only possible culprit I found in the manual was something called "Passive Alarm". I think this needs to be activated and deactivated by the dealer. The car was delivered with the security system upgrade to the dealer and they removed it since we did not want it. I'm thinking they may have done something when they removed the security upgrade. Any ideas? Anyone have similar problems? We might be taking it back to the dealer to be looked at on Monday.
